<p>A clock (H) delivers pulses having a period (T) and digital circuits (2,3,4) count the number of complete pulses between starting and finishing signals (D,F) to produce a rough measurement of the time interval. Analogue circuits (6,8,10,12,14) are used to determine the starting and finishing unmeasured intervals. The analogue circuits generate a number (N) of linear ramps which have the same period as the clock (T) and are displaced from each other by a time T/N. The starting and finishing times coincide with the central flat portion of at least one ramp and amplitude measurements enable the starting and finishing unmeasured time intervals to be determined from the known ramp slope.</p> |
